| Textbook | Focus | Best For | Comparison to Khalil | | :--- | :--- | :--- | :--- | | Slotine & Li | Applied Nonlinear Control | Robotics, Mechanical Eng. | Less rigorous, more intuitive. Great for first pass. | | Isidori | Nonlinear Control Systems | Pure differential geometry | Extremely advanced. The "bible" for feedback linearization. | | Sastry | Nonlinear Systems | Hybrid systems, advanced math | More mathematical breadth. | | Khalil (Nonlinear Control) | Balance of theory & application | First-year grad / Senior UG | The “sweet spot” for most engineers. | It includes deeper mathematical analysis like the Comparison
